Bethesda and Make-A-Wish Mid-Atlantic recently teamed up for a special fan initiative impacting the development of the upcoming Elder Scrolls VI RPG.

An anonymous fan won the chance to have a character in TES VI modeled after themselves or based on their design, with a winning bid of $85,450. The auction saw participation from both individual players and large fan communities, including UESP and The Imperial Library, who attempted to honor community member Lorrane Pairrel.
Although Bethesda hasn't disclosed the winning character's details, speculation is rife among fans. Some express concerns about potential lore inconsistencies, while others celebrate the community's involvement.
